What is it?
===========
A simple time tracking utility.
Why?
====
I tried karm and gtt and didn't like them. I find it useful - someone
else might too.
Installation
============
Drop it in ~/vim/ftplugin/. When you open a file with the modline telling
vim that the filetype is "timelog":
" vim:ft=timelog:
it'll be sourced. I personally have an alias to check out (RCS) my
timelog file, open it with vim and check it back in when I'm finished.
Usage
=====
Keys:
n new job
t start timing highlighted job (or job with the cursor on it)
q stop timing
s[1-9] sort by that column
Here's an example of what mine could look like:
" vim:ft=timelog:
" usage:
" t go
" q stop
" n new job
" s[1-9] sort by that column
" dates in yy-mm-dd time in hh:mm:ss
start last time what?
-------- -------- -------- -------
03-11-03 03-11-03 00:10:23 O ---- Write doc for timelog.vim
02-11-19 03-10-19 05:19:02 C 0712 something
02-11-19 02-11-19 00:14:41 C 0977 something else
03-11-03 03-11-03 00:00:00 N ---- blah
The first 3 columns are what timelog.vim give you - when the job was
created, when it was last modified and time spent on it. The rest can be
whatever you like. For me here I have a tag for whether the job is New,
Open or Completed (N, O, C), a reference nuber for the job if I have one
and a description.
There can be several timlog blocks seperated by white space and can have
text between. Each timelog block can be sorted seperately.
Bugs?
=====
Well, the seconds aren't quite seconds and not all motions highlight the
line the cursor ends up on. |
